I rode this ride while stationed in SK. It was a fun ride, but uncomfortable due to riding it hunched over like on a bike. We went in Nov(the weather/seasons in SK are the same as IN/OH) so I was a little worried about getting wet, but it never touches the water, just comes really close to it. They have jets that spray water when the car comes close to the water.
